Transaction 21ee70cddacea0f07150c011514aad7a2be083ae5ef4c071e4881b73bbc2a2a1

1 Input
2 Outputs
  • 21ee70cddacea0f07150c011514aad7a2be083ae5ef4c071e4881b73bbc2a2a1:0
  • value  2306000
    address  3FMJtSnBkMwgieLMaxBujqtW7pLHCMgYYp
  • 21ee70cddacea0f07150c011514aad7a2be083ae5ef4c071e4881b73bbc2a2a1:1
  • value  6405185
    address  1HAzrxSXZttD1QEKExxDjmHMmwEVoVdUSa